Output 43cec570636fa272c6f62b104170d55dd084e9708ec877297fab4d351b55016a:1

value
667749
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f858a8f8a069c22dae3fef5076a9db6c71c7807 OP_EQUALVERIFY OP_CHECKSIG
address
15LGjdFHF1Q5ZATqDxrM9G77K3AKtDkcvZ
transaction
43cec570636fa272c6f62b104170d55dd084e9708ec877297fab4d351b55016a
spent
true